    Default Site map and robots.txt files?

    I ran a "search engine visibilty" test from GoDaddy on my site. It said I needed (1) a site map. I can't find anything in Xara help on it. What's the best way to go about this? Do I just write my page titles in small print at the bottom of my page and link them to each page?

    And (2) it said I had no robots.txt file. What's that all about? Can't find info on that either.

    Default Re: Site map and robots.txt files?

    Hi MJW

    From the (F1) help file under "sitemap"

    Website URL: Enter the full URL of your published website here if you would like to automatically generate an XML Sitemap, which is a list of the pages on your website, helps search engines find all the pages in your site. When you export your website, a file called Sitemap.xml is also created in the main export folder. If no URL is specified here when you export your website, no sitemap is created.

    Note: Because a valid Sitemap must include the full URL of the website, a Sitemap can only be generated if the website URL is available.
    Robots.txt file are handy if you wish to hide files or folders from the search engines

    Default Re: Site map and robots.txt files?

    In the Website Properties > Publish tab, you have the option to generate a SiteMap. It's easy. All you have to do is specify your website URL and the site map is automatically generated when you publish your site.

    Default Re: Site map and robots.txt files?

    Is there a way to have Web Designer create a VIDEO SITEMAP ??
    Not a chance. There's no such facility for WD to do this.
    You must create the XML yourself and submit it via your Google Webmaster Tools login.
    See: ► http://support.google.com/webmasters...n&answer=80472

    There is VSM Generator software available to help out (Google it), including an ad supported freebie.
